[16a-Z35-8] Visualization of impact stress and propagation wave by mechanoluminescence imaging

Junichirou Hama1,2, Takamasa Iwata1,2, Chao-Nan XU1,2 (1.AIST, 2.Kyushu Univ.)

Keywords:Mechanoluminescnence, Impact stress, Stress distribution

Mechanoluminescnence(ML) material is an inorganic material capable of expressing mechanical information by emission. In this study, we analyzed the instantaneous emission phenomenon in microseconds due to impact using a high-speed camera and ML material. In the experiment, a test piece was impacted by a hammer, and a sheet of ML material was adhered to the back surface of the impact surface. At that time, ML phenomenon which exhibited on the back surface was photographed with a high-speed camera, and the strain was evaluated using a triaxial strain gauge. We were able to capture the propagation of impact stress from the image on the back. In addition, we found that ML and strain value of light emission phenomenon are matched as relationship between ML and strain.
